The Repudiation Of State Debts: A Study In The Financial History Of Mississippi, Florida, Alabama, North Carolina, South Carolina, Georgia, Louisiana, Arkansas, Tennessee, Minnesota, Michigan And Virginia is a comprehensive analysis of the history of state debts in various states of the United States. The book is written by William A. Scott and provides a detailed account of the financial situation of these states during the early 19th century.The book focuses on the repudiation of state debts in these states and examines the reasons behind such actions. It also explores the impact of these actions on the economy and the people of these states. The author provides a detailed analysis of the political and economic factors that led to the repudiation of state debts and the consequences of these actions.The book covers a wide range of topics related to the financial history of these states, including the role of banks and financial institutions, the impact of the Civil War on the economy, and the development of the agricultural and industrial sectors. It also delves into the social and cultural factors that shaped the financial history of these states.Overall, The Repudiation Of State Debts: A Study In The Financial History Of Mississippi, Florida, Alabama, North Carolina, South Carolina, Georgia, Louisiana, Arkansas, Tennessee, Minnesota, Michigan And Virginia is a valuable resource for anyone interested in the financial history of the United States.
